Hotel Features. Boasting A Very Impressive Outdoor Water Complex, Rio Has Four Lagoon-style Pools, Five Spa Tubs And A Sandy Beach That Are Punctuated By Cascading Waterfalls, Tremendous Palm Trees And Desert Rock Formations That Seem To Erupt From The Ground. Stage Productions Include The Quirky, Cerebral Humor Of Penn & Teller In The Samba Theatre, And The Off-broadway Hit Show Tony N'tina's. For Adults Only, Showgirls And Chippendale Dancers Perform Regularly At Club Rio. Erocktica, A Rock And Roll And Exotic Dance Revue, Also Draws Worldwide Attention. A $2 Million Renovation Transformed The Famous Voodoo Caf? And Lounge Where Guests Marvel At Mystical Sights And Breathtaking Views From Two Outdoor Patios That Hover Above The Strip. From Casual Cafes To Fine Dining, The Hotel Boasts 15 Different Food Venues, Where Guests Will Certainly Find The Environment That Best Suites Their Needs.
Guestrooms. With Floor-to-ceiling Windows, Partial Canopy Beds And Lounge Furniture, Each Of The 2,540 Suites Is An Inviting Space With Attractive Amenities. These Guestroom Suites Feature Internet Access, Multi-line Telephones, Refrigerators And Minibars. Panoramic Views Of The Nearby Las Vegas Strip Remind Guests Of The Hotel's Versatile Location, Quietly Removed From The Chaos Of Sin City, But Still Within Reach Of The Same.

The Extravagances Of Rio De Janeiro's Carnaval Celebrations Are Faithfully Re-enacted Seven Times A Day At The Rio All-suite Hotel And Casino, Located One Mile East Of The Las Vegas Strip. One Of Nevada's Most Vibrant Vacation Destinations, Rio Is Renowned For Its Aerial Show That Parades Through Masquerade Village In Celebration Of Brazil's Infamous Tradition.
